I did lighten up his face with a dodge/burn layer. Sometimes the challenge is not going to far where it no longer looks realistic. Perhaps I could have gone further. This layer is pretty easy, just create a new layer, soft light blend mode and check the fill 50% gray box, and use either white brush to lighten or black brush to darken. A very handy tool! |
